Output cd896230556c309a26454033c9fa768fcea3943cbb2125a2e9d20ff2ae36cc09:11

value
2950707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59694915932785272ceb7ad4e7336e88b5bb5e22 OP_EQUAL
address
39qnBypSnnzQJF5TK2MZeDTWZCVEVRDYqC
transaction
cd896230556c309a26454033c9fa768fcea3943cbb2125a2e9d20ff2ae36cc09
spent
true